The Regulatory Landscape: A Balancing Act
Given the moral and social concerns associated with gambling, Australian authorities have historically maintained strict regulatory oversight. The core legislation governing online casinos is encapsulated within the Interactive Gambling Act 2001 (IGA). This act prohibits the operation of unlicensed online casino services accessible within Australia, aiming to prevent gambling operators from targeting Australian consumers without appropriate licensing conducted within the legal framework.
However, this approach has faced scrutiny. Critics argue that the prohibitionist stance fosters a black market for online gambling, which hampers consumer protection and tax revenue collection. Industry experts note that many Australians access online casino platforms through offshore entities, which complicates enforcement and exposes players to unregulated risks.
Industry Evolution and Consumer Behavior
Despite regulatory restrictions, the demand for online casino gaming persists, driven by innovative platforms, mobile accessibility, and improved user experiences. Data from industry analysts indicate that the online gambling market in Australia has grown by approximately 12% annually over the last five years, reflecting both increased consumer engagement and technological proliferation.
Operators have responded by adopting more sophisticated security measures, customizable game interfaces, and integrated responsible gambling tools, such as self-exclusion options and spending limits. These developments demonstrate a nuanced industry adapting to regulatory constraints while maintaining profitability and consumer trust.
Emerging Technologies and Responsible Gambling
Innovations in artificial intelligence (AI), biometrics, and blockchain are poised to redefine online gambling credibility. AI-driven data analytics facilitate personalized experiences while enhancing security and detecting problematic betting patterns early. Blockchain offers transparency in transactions, fostering trust between operators and players.
Particularly relevant is the integration of responsible gambling protocols, which aim to minimize harm and promote healthier engagement. For instance, platforms now incorporate real-time behavioral tracking, automatically flagging signs of compulsive behavior and providing tools for self-assessment. These technological strides underscore industry commitment to responsible gambling, aligning with regulatory interests.
